- Licensing | State Fire Marshal, KS # Licensing Unlike many other State Fire Marshal agencies, we do not charge a fee for our inspection and plans review services at this time.
- However, there are a few programs which require additional staff or additional services for which we do charge a fee.
- The state budget situation constantly changes, if any changes are made to our fee structure we will notify and post accordingly.
